The submitter has given permission to the USGenWeb Archives to store the file permanently for free access. ------------------------------------------------------------------------------ There are several graves that have long since been unreadable. They only had the little tags put there by the funeral home. Kolli Tuklo, Watson Ok. Turn left going toward Post Office. There is a blue sign beside a little bitty road. Go down the little bitty road toward the Old Indian Church Kolli Tuklo. Go past the camp house and to the churchyard. Look down toward the outhouse and you will see the tombstones. James Sina 02 Dec 1966 Age76 James Charles 1905 1975 PFC US ARMY WWII Watson Isaac 06 Nov 1925 20 Sep 1965 S1 USNR WWII Watson Ronald 1947 1993 Watson Narsie 20 Sep 1891 23 Jun 1956 Married to Larson Watson. Watson Larson 04 Feb 1884 01 Oct 1959 Married to Narsie Robinson Jane 1883 1976 Brown Listie 1913 1980 McGee Alonzo 17 Aug 1925 15 Jan 1992 McGee Lindsey 17 Dec 1921 12 Oct 1982 TEC 5 US ARMY WWII McGee Nathan Lee 1955 1996 The McGee's are related to Dusty (McGee) Bohanan.
